Carbon monoxide (CO) is a colorless, odorless, and tasteless gas that is produced by the incomplete combustion of fossil fuels. It is often referred to as the "silent killer" because it is impossible to detect without proper equipment. The odor of carbon monoxide is non-existent, making it particularly dangerous as it can go undetected in enclosed spaces. Understanding the sources, symptoms, and prevention methods of carbon monoxide poisoning is crucial for ensuring safety in homes and workplaces.

Understanding Carbon Monoxide

Carbon monoxide is produced by the incomplete burning of fuels such as coal, wood, charcoal, oil, kerosene, propane, and natural gas. Common sources of carbon monoxide include:

  • Furnaces and boilers
  • Water heaters
  • Fireplaces and wood stoves
  • Gas stoves and ovens
  • Portable generators
  • Automobiles
  • Grills and camp stoves

Because carbon monoxide is odorless and colorless, it is essential to have detectors installed in homes and workplaces. These detectors can alert occupants to the presence of carbon monoxide, allowing them to take immediate action.

Symptoms of Carbon Monoxide Poisoning

Exposure to carbon monoxide can lead to a variety of symptoms, ranging from mild to severe. The severity of symptoms depends on the level of exposure and the duration of exposure. Common symptoms include:

  • Headache
  • Dizziness
  • Weakness
  • Nausea
  • Vomiting
  • Chest pain
  • Confusion
  • Shortness of breath
  • Blurred vision
  • Loss of consciousness

In severe cases, carbon monoxide poisoning can be fatal. It is crucial to recognize the symptoms and take immediate action if exposure is suspected.

Prevention of Carbon Monoxide Poisoning

Preventing carbon monoxide poisoning involves several key steps. Here are some essential measures to ensure safety:

Install Carbon Monoxide Detectors

Carbon monoxide detectors are designed to alert occupants to the presence of carbon monoxide in the air. These detectors should be installed in every level of the home, including the basement and near sleeping areas. Regularly test the detectors to ensure they are functioning properly and replace the batteries as needed.

Maintain Heating Systems

Regular maintenance of heating systems, including furnaces, boilers, and water heaters, is essential for preventing carbon monoxide leaks. Have these systems inspected annually by a professional to ensure they are operating safely and efficiently.

Ventilation

Ensure proper ventilation in areas where fuel-burning appliances are used. This includes using exhaust fans in kitchens and bathrooms, and ensuring that chimneys and vents are clear of obstructions.

Avoid Using Fuel-Burning Appliances Indoors

Never use portable generators, grills, camp stoves, or other fuel-burning appliances indoors or in enclosed spaces. These appliances produce carbon monoxide and can quickly lead to dangerous levels of the gas in confined areas.

Educate Family Members

Educate all family members about the dangers of carbon monoxide and the importance of recognizing the symptoms of poisoning. Ensure that everyone knows what to do in case of a carbon monoxide alarm or suspected exposure.

What to Do If You Suspect Carbon Monoxide Poisoning

If you suspect carbon monoxide poisoning, take the following steps immediately:

  • Evacuate the area immediately and move to a well-ventilated location.
  • Call emergency services and report the suspected poisoning.
  • Do not re-enter the area until it has been declared safe by a professional.
  • Seek medical attention if you or anyone else is experiencing symptoms of carbon monoxide poisoning.

It is crucial to act quickly in case of suspected carbon monoxide poisoning, as the gas can be fatal if not addressed promptly.

Carbon Monoxide Detectors: Types and Features

Carbon monoxide detectors come in various types and with different features. Understanding the options available can help you choose the best detector for your needs.

Types of Carbon Monoxide Detectors

There are two main types of carbon monoxide detectors:

  • Battery-operated detectors
  • Hardwired detectors

Battery-operated detectors are portable and can be placed anywhere in the home. Hardwired detectors are connected to the home's electrical system and often come with a battery backup.

Features to Consider

When choosing a carbon monoxide detector, consider the following features:

  • Digital display: Shows the current level of carbon monoxide in the air.
  • Peak level memory: Records the highest level of carbon monoxide detected.
  • Low battery indicator: Alerts you when the batteries need to be replaced.
  • End-of-life indicator: Lets you know when it's time to replace the detector.
  • Interconnectivity: Allows multiple detectors to communicate with each other, so if one detector goes off, all detectors will sound the alarm.

Selecting a detector with these features can enhance your safety and provide peace of mind.

Carbon Monoxide Poisoning in Different Settings

Carbon monoxide poisoning can occur in various settings, including homes, workplaces, and recreational areas. Understanding the risks in different environments can help prevent exposure.

Home Settings

In homes, carbon monoxide poisoning often results from improperly maintained heating systems, blocked chimneys, or the use of fuel-burning appliances indoors. Ensure that all fuel-burning appliances are properly vented and maintained, and install carbon monoxide detectors on every level of the home.

Workplace Settings

In workplaces, carbon monoxide poisoning can occur in garages, warehouses, and other areas where fuel-burning equipment is used. Employers should ensure proper ventilation, regular maintenance of equipment, and the installation of carbon monoxide detectors in areas where the risk of exposure is high.

Recreational Settings

Recreational settings, such as camping and boating, also pose a risk of carbon monoxide poisoning. Never use portable generators, grills, or camp stoves in enclosed spaces, such as tents or cabins. Ensure proper ventilation when using these appliances outdoors.

Carbon Monoxide Poisoning Statistics

Carbon monoxide poisoning is a significant public health concern. According to the Centers for Disease Control and Prevention (CDC), approximately 430 people in the United States die from accidental carbon monoxide poisoning each year, and more than 50,000 people visit the emergency room due to carbon monoxide poisoning.

These statistics highlight the importance of taking preventive measures to protect against carbon monoxide poisoning. By installing detectors, maintaining heating systems, and educating family members, you can significantly reduce the risk of exposure.

Carbon Monoxide Poisoning in Specific Populations

Certain populations are at higher risk of carbon monoxide poisoning due to factors such as age, health conditions, and living situations. Understanding these risks can help in implementing targeted prevention strategies.

Infants and Children

Infants and children are particularly vulnerable to carbon monoxide poisoning due to their smaller body size and developing respiratory systems. Ensure that carbon monoxide detectors are installed in areas where children sleep and play, and educate caregivers about the symptoms of poisoning.

Elderly Individuals

Elderly individuals may be at higher risk of carbon monoxide poisoning due to age-related health conditions and reduced mobility. Ensure that carbon monoxide detectors are installed in their living areas and that caregivers are aware of the symptoms of poisoning.

Pregnant Women

Pregnant women and their unborn children are at increased risk of carbon monoxide poisoning. Exposure to carbon monoxide can affect the developing fetus and lead to complications such as low birth weight and developmental delays. Ensure that carbon monoxide detectors are installed in areas where pregnant women spend time, and educate them about the symptoms of poisoning.

Carbon Monoxide Poisoning and Pets

Pets are also at risk of carbon monoxide poisoning. Because pets are often more sensitive to environmental changes, they may show symptoms of poisoning before humans do. If you suspect carbon monoxide poisoning in your pet, take the following steps:

  • Evacuate the area immediately and move to a well-ventilated location.
  • Call your veterinarian or emergency services for advice.
  • Do not re-enter the area until it has been declared safe by a professional.

Ensure that carbon monoxide detectors are installed in areas where pets spend time, and educate family members about the symptoms of poisoning in pets.
